  • Pattern Grammer: A Corpus-Driven Approach to the Lexical Grammer of English
  • Written by author Gill Francis, Susan Hunston
  • Published by Benjamins, John Publishing Company, 1/28/2000
  • This book describes an approach to lexis and grammar based on the concept of phraseology and of language patterning arising from work on large corpora. The notion of 'pattern' as a systematic way of dealing with the interface between lexis and grammar was

Acknowledgements
Ch. 1 A Short History of Patterns 1
1.1 About this book 1
1.2 Hornby: A Guide to Patterns and Usage in English 3
1.3 Lexical phrases 7
1.4 Sinclair: Corpus Concordance Collocation 14
1.5 Francis: A corpus-driven grammar 29
1.6 COBUILD: the grammar patterns series 32
Ch. 2 What a pattern is 37
2.1 A word and its patterns 37
2.2 A pattern and its words 43
2.3 The representation of patterns 44
2.4 What's in a pattern? 49
2.5 What kinds of pattern are there? 51
2.6 Looking at patterns from all sides 58
2.7 Different forms of a pattern 59
Ch. 3 Problems in identifying patterns 67
3.1 Which word does the pattern belong to? 68
3.2 When is a pattern not a pattern? 71
3.3 Do patterns over-generalise? 77
Ch. 4 Patterns and Meaning 83
4.1 Meaning groups: some examples 83
4.2 Creativity in pattern use 95
Ch. 5 More on pattern and meaning 109
5.1 From meaning to pattern: lexis and function 109
5.2 Mapping meaning on to pattern 123
5.3 Semantic word groups and their pattern distribution 142
App. to Chapter 5 146
Ch. 6 Pattern and structure 151
6.1 Relating pattern to structure 151
6.2 Problems with prepositional phrases 160
6.3 Problems with phase 169
Ch. 7 Word class and pattern 179
7.1 The word class as pattern set 179
7.2 Some 'new' word classes 181
7.3 Some problematic word classes 192
7.4 Words without classes 195
7.5 Are word classes necessary? 197
Ch. 8 Text and Pattern 199
8.1 Patterns in running text 199
8.2 Pattern flow 207
8.3 Pattern configurations 215
8.4 Collocation and clause collocation 225
8.5 The theory of a linear grammar 235
Ch. 9 Summing Up 247
9.1 Patterns and phraseologies 247
9.2 Questions of theory 249
9.3 Questions of application to pedagogy 261
References 275
Appendix 283
Name Index 285
Subject Index 289
